ABSTRACT:
A tire for a large vehicle includes bead portions having bead cores around which a carcass ply layer is turned up from an inside to an outside of the tire. The tire includes a first elastomer protective layer A, a second elastomer protective layer B and a third elastomer protective layer C. These protective layers A, B and C have dynamic storage moduli E' A: 7-20.times.10.sup.7 (dyn/cm.sup.2), B: 10-25.times.10.sup.7 (dyn/cm.sup.2) and C: 2-10.times.10.sup.7 (dyn/cm.sup.2) and relations of the dynamic storage moduli in B>A>C, B-A>2.times.10.sup.7 and A-C>2.times.10.sup.7, and have loss tangents .delta. A: 0.15-0.22, B: 0.18-0.25 and C: 0.05-0.16 and a relation of loss tangents in B>A>C.
